Recommendations and Best Practices on Competition Law and Policy

The OECD Council has adopted a number of non-binding Recommendations on competition law and policy. In addition, the Competition Committee has adopted Best Practices. These Recommendations and Best Practices are often catalysts for major change by governments.

 

2011 - Revised Recommendation concerning structural separation in regulated industries

 

2009 - Guidelines for fighting bid rigging in public procurement

 

2009 - Recommendation on competition assessment

 

2005 - Guiding Principles for regulatory quality and performance

 

2005 - Best Practices for the formal exchange of information between competition authorities in hard core cartel investigations

 

2005 - Recommendation on merger review

 

2001 - Recommendation concerning structural separation in regulated industries

 

1998 - Recommendation concerning effective action against hard core cartels

 

1995 - Recommendation concerning co-operation between member countries on anticompetitive practices affecting international trade

 

1979 - Recommendation on competition policy and exempted or regulated sectors
